Because fresh water is less dense than saltwater, it resists sinking, which threatens to slow down or disrupt the entire Thermohaline Circulation. A disruption of this scale could result in drastic climate shifts, including severe winter storms in Europe and rapidly rising sea levels along the eastern coast of North America. The friction between blowing wind and the surface of the water creates surface currents. These currents transfer heat around the planet, moving warm water from the equator toward the poles.
